Thursday night’s matchup between the Milwaukee Bucks and San Antonio Spurs had been one to watch for quite some time, as it was the first-ever meeting between Bucks forward Giannis Antetokounmpo and Spurs center Victor Wembanyama.
The teams met in Milwaukee on December 19, as the Bucks cruised to a 132-119 win, but Wembanyama missed the game with a sore ankle.
Thursday night, however, he was in action and the game lived up to the hype, with Milwaukee pulling out a 125-121 victory in San Antonio.
Giannis led all scorers with 44 points and 14 rebounds, while Wembanyama finished with 27 points and nine rebounds to go along with five blocked shots.
The entire game was good, but the highlights were absolutely when the two players would go at each other, which can be seen below.
It’s a shame that as long as the players are in different conferences we’ll only get this matchup twice a year, but if it’s this good every time, we’re all in for quite a treat over the next few years.
